Some people will unfold you like a letter and others will seal you in an envelope so tight you would think it was empty. Some people will special order you off a menu with 100 choices and others will spit you out and refuse to taste again. Some people will bathe in you and drink from your secondly spout and others will throw garbage in you and claim to be saving something else.

You will meet people on both sides of this and you think that you are learning about them. You are learning their likes and dislikes and what they eat on their pizza, but I'm telling you you're really learning yourself. You meet pieces of you over and over and all the traits and lessons you take away are really the physical, emotional, chemical elements of you. Your periodic table.

You will eat lunch with someone every day and realize you hate the sound of people chewing.

You will do the day with someone and proceed to do the night. Day after week after month you learn how much can be said in silence.

You will listen to music in the dark with someone and realize you both hear the words differently at night.

You will run around town with someone and realize you love not checking the time.

You will have your mind stolen from someone and realize no one has ever had your heart.

You will go swimming with someone and promise yourself to never touch cold water.

Someone will meet you and see your beauty and rhyme. You will meet them and hear their voice as the thin part of a marker. Years will go by and memories will be made, but after they're gone you'll realize you never liked that sound.
